Adam's Woman
(1970)Overview
Adam is a young American wrongly accused of being an accomplice to murder while on shore leave in Liverpool. He is sentenced to death by hanging but the sentence is commuted to twenty years in a convict settlement in Australia.
Featured Crew
- Director : Philip Leacock
- Producer : Louis F. Edelman,Arthur M. Broidy
- Writer : Richard Fiedler
- Cast : Beau Bridges,Jane Merrow,John Mills,James Booth,Andrew Keir,Tracy Reed,Clarissa Kaye-Mason
